My BIM Modeling Approach
When working on a BIM project, I believe accuracy and organization are equally important. A model may look good visually, but it should also be structured properly so that it can be used effectively throughout the project.
I begin by reviewing the available drawings and project information. I check dimensions, levels, grids, room layouts, wall locations, openings, roof forms, floor arrangements, and other important elements before developing the model. If information is unclear or inconsistent, I prefer to identify the issue early rather than making assumptions that could affect the final model.
During the modeling process, I pay attention to the relationship between different building components. Walls, floors, ceilings, roofs, doors, windows, stairs, rooms, structural elements, and other components should be positioned correctly and coordinated with one another.
I also aim to maintain a clean project structure. Proper naming, organization, levels, views, families, and model elements can make the BIM file easier for other professionals to understand and modify.

2D CAD to 3D BIM Conversion
One of the services I can provide is converting existing 2D drawings into 3D BIM models.
Many clients have existing floor plans or CAD drawings but need a three-dimensional model for design development, visualization, coordination, documentation, or future project use. I can use the provided drawings as a reference for developing the corresponding BIM model.
The conversion process may involve reviewing the source drawings, identifying building levels, interpreting wall layouts, locating doors and windows, creating floors and roofs, developing vertical elements, and adding other required components.
